Oklahoma is welcoming the third highest number of Afghan refugees. There are plenty of voices saying plenty of things, but we're asking: "What does it mean to think Biblically about this?" In this episode, we'll teach a few principles that are central to the Bible and central to this topic. We'll also share why you need to quit listening to voices that are shouting instructions antithetical to the cause of Jesus.
